James Kenneth Ralston was born in Choteau, Montana, on March 31, 1896. His paternal grandparents, left Independence, Missouri, by ox team for the gold camps of Colorado in 1859. His father was the first born to Samuel F. and Mary Gregg Ralston. In 1863, they headed for Idaho, and in 1864 they moved to the Alder Gulch area in the Montana Territory. In the spring of 1878, his father, Will Ralston, moved the Ralston cattle to the Teton River near Choteau, Montana. In 1885, Will Ralston married Ellen Mathewson and they had five children of which James Kenneth Ralston was the fifth child. In 1903, Will Ralston took over as the general manager of the Flying U Ranch near Choteau, Montana. They then moved to Helena where James Kenneth Ralston received his first formal art instruction.
